Laura Scher Joins Board of LightFull

We’re thrilled to announce that Laura Scher, renowned social entrepreneur, co-founder, chairperson and chief executive officer of Working Assets, and personal hero of Lara and Lynn, has joined the board of LightFull Foods! Since Laura started Working Assets in 1985, she has proved that it is possible to build a rock solid business and a better world at the same time – all while raising 2 kids. Working Assets is a long distance, credit card and wireless company that supports positive social change by donating a percentage of its revenue to progressive nonprofit groups. “It’s incredibly satisfying to know that a community of kindred spirits can have an enormous impact,” said Laura. Fiber: The Superfood

It should come as no surprise that we here at LightFull are huge fans of fiber. It’s filling and contributes to satiety, which is why there are at least 5 grams in each of our yummy smoothies.
